Output 73f30fc2b85bef389f30dbdab9f1dba22ebba3ed95de0651e4d0c34634727fd8:0

value
6953345213843
script pubkey
OP_0 OP_PUSHBYTES_20 e59e99146b5774c6d56e2fa49fb1a60ce6cf2cc8
address
tb1quk0fj9rt2a6vd4tw97jflvdxpnnv7txgx4fx7p
transaction
73f30fc2b85bef389f30dbdab9f1dba22ebba3ed95de0651e4d0c34634727fd8
spent
true